Satari
Satari is a village located in Jagadhri tehsil of Yamunanagar district in Haryana,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Jagadhri (tehsildar office) and 25km away from district headquarter Yamunanagar. As per 2009 stats, Satari village is also a gram panchayat.

About Satari
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Satari is 057682. The village spans a total geographical area of 159 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 133103. Jagadhri is nearest town to Satari village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Satari village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Sadhaura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Ambala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Satari
According to the 2011 Census, Satari has a total population of about 485, with approximately 249 males and 236 females. The sex ratio is around 947 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 53 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 182 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 72.58%, with male literacy at about 75.50% and female literacy near 69.49%. There are around 96 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 485 | 249 | 236 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 53 | 27 | 26 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 182 | 91 | 91 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 352 | 188 | 164 |
Illiterate Population | 133 | 61 | 72 |
Connectivity of Satari
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Satari. As per the 2011 stats, Satari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
